Reverting to Dual Domain from a 3D Mesh

I used to have a procedure (and probably a macro) to revert to a dual domain mesh from a 3d mesh, however I can no longer find it.  Can someone give me a hand?

Hello,

 

Look in the help, on the contents select :

Modeling-The mesh-Meshing the model- Dual domain mesh, and then look on procedures tab.

 

Steps are explained how to get a dual domain mesh from a 3D mesh.

It's easy to do. 

 

Change your mesh type back to Dual Domain.  Then mesh your part again. 

 

It can take a while for the remesh, but it always does the trick.
